Yeah, that's very strange! I can't seem to reproduce it here. Could you send me a debug log? Here are the steps:
  • On the DisplayFusion Settings > Troubleshooting tab, change the Logging drop-down to "L1: Log Minimal" and click Apply
  • Reproduce the issue and note the time so we'll know where to check in the log file
  • Send us the DisplayFusion.log and DebugInfo.html files (can be found by clicking the Open Log button on the Troubleshooting tab)
  • Disable debug logging after sending the log

Thanks! I finally found the missing clue in your screenshots. When testing, I was selecting the same image manually for each monitor. Today I noticed that you have it set to "Same Image on Each Monitor." After setting mine to that, I can reproduce this issue :)

I've added it to our list and we'll be sure to let you know when it's all fixed up.
